这篇文章简单介绍了MySQL中IN的用法详解的相关资料,需要的朋友可以参考下

说到Mysql 的 in 运算符可能有些新手还没有使用过,导致在项目中多了很多不必要的麻烦

今天简单的说说 in 的用法~

in 运算符用于 where 表达式中,以列表项的形式支持多个选择,语法如下:

where column in (value1,value2,value3,...)where column not in (value1,value2,value3,...)

当 in 前面加上 not 运算符时,表示与 in 相反的意思,即不在这些列表项内选择。

例如现在有一张表的数据是这样

然后输入一下sql语句查询

select * from sys_user where id in (2,3) //可以看做是:select * from sys_user where (id=2,id=3)

结果

可以看到他筛选出来了id为2、3的用户

如果在前面加上 not ,结果相信大家也知道啦~

在 in ()中不仅可以用数字,也可以用字符串,甚至可以用日期时间~但是要记得在字符串上加上引号

The end!!!

MySQL——IN的用法详解相关推荐

  1. pdo mysql limit_PHP mysql中limit用法详解(代码示例)

    在MySQL中,LIMIT子句与SELECT语句一起使用,以限制结果集中的行数.LIMIT子句接受一个或两个offset和count的参数.这两个参数的值都可以是零或正整数. offset:用于指定要 ...

  2. 【MySQL】explain 用法详解

    [MySQL]explain 用法详解   explain命令主要来查看SQL语句的执行计划,查看该SQL语句有没有使用索引,有没有做全表扫描等.它可以模拟优化器执行SQL查询语句,从而知道MySQL ...

  3. MySQL中Explain用法详解

    Explain简介 我们在写后端程序的时候,通常会写sql来查询数据,如果是单表查询的时候,那直接select就完事了,但是如果是连表查询数据量也不小的话,就造成了查询速度会比较慢,那么我们该怎么知道 ...

  4. MySQL where in 用法详解

    IN 运算符用于 WHERE 表达式中,以列表项的形式支持多个选择,这里分两种情况来介绍 WHERE column IN (value1,value2,-) WHERE column NOT IN ( ...

  5. mysql中member_Membership用法详解

    用户与角色管理在asp.net2.0中是通过Membership和Roles两个类来实现的. Membership:用户成员账号管理,用户名.密码.邮箱等 Roles:负责用户和群组之间关系管理. l ...

  6. mysql left join用法详解

    文章目录 1. left join 2. 实例 3. SQL语句举例 4. 总结 1. left join LEFT JOIN:寻找left join左边的表的记录. 系统会将A表与B表进行笛卡尔积运 ...

  7. MySQL的Replace用法详解

    replace into平时在开发中很少用到,这次是因为在做一个生成分布式ID的开源项目,调研雅虎推出的一个基于数据库生成唯一id生成方案:flickr 碰到的一个知识盲点,仅以此篇记录一下. 一.r ...

  8. mysql查询replace用法详解

    语法 REPLACE ( string_expression , string_pattern , string_replacement ) 参数 string_expression 要搜索的字符串表 ...

  9. mysql常见关键字的用法_MySQL 常用关键字用法详解

    MySQL 常用关键字用法详解 在开发工程中,操作数据库的时候经常会有不同类型的条件查询,除了使用where外,Mysql本身也提供了很多常用的关键字.本文主要介绍一些常用的关键字,像update.i ...

最新文章

  1. Bert需要理解的一些内容
  2. 【译】Object Dumper: 函数式程序设计编码中的强大工具
  3. SharePoint 2010 新体验7 - Managed Metadata (托管元数据)
  4. 2017第八届蓝桥杯C/C++ B组省赛 —— 第一题:购物单
  5. kubernetes1.8.4安装指南 -- 5. 证书生成
  6. 使用NUnit进行DotNet程序测试
  7. HttpSendRequest向服务端发送数据,构造请求http头
  8. Caffe学习1 :ProtoBuffer
  9. IIS 管理器无法验证此内置帐户是否有访问权
  10. Atitit 人工智能体系树 常用技术 2. 知识图谱 知识处理系统 2 知识发现 知识图谱 1. 1.NLP 2 自然语言处理文本处理 1.1. 语言理解 分词 2 抽取 (压缩文
  11. 毕设讲解之 --- 如何完成小程序毕业设计
  12. 【Photoshop 教程系列第 3 篇】如何在 PS 中修改图片的分辨率和大小(一步一步详细说明)
  13. Python编写三角形
  14. 数据结构与算法01:绪论【LEARN FROM 李春葆《数据结构教程》】
  15. ubuntu找不到拼音输入,找不到中文拼音输入源
  16. Oracle Spatial详解
  17. VScode设置语言为中文成功,菜单栏仍然显示成英文状态
  18. Python Day11 魔方方法
  19. bapi sap 创建物料_SAP调用BAPI创建物料主数据
  20. 杨百万:股市就要见顶了 但没前一次悲惨

热门文章

  1. Java程序性能优化-概述
  2. python调用默认播放器_python使用Tkinter实现在线音乐播放器
  3. java中容易产生空指针异常:NullPointerException的场景
  4. 管理口安装服务器操作系统,管理口安装服务器操作系统
  5. java web JSP实用教程第二章
  6. 基于 MSP430 CC1101的WOR的测试
  7. Eclipse插件配置
  8. MySQL的Schema是什么?
  9. Oracle11g for Windows
  10. 动环监控串口,动环监控系统接口